| Tissue Specificity | Expressed in colon, kidney, liver, pancreas, adenocarcinoma and endometrium. |
| Function | Catalyzes the NADPH-dependent reduction of various carbonyl-containing compounds, including aldehydes, ketones, and toxic products from cellular metabolism or environmental exposure. Can reduce the dialdehyde form of aflatoxin B1 (AFB1) into alcohol derivatives, via monoaldehydes intermediates, thus preventing the formation of protein adducts that contribute to AFB1-induced toxicity. |
